Boy injured after receiving electric shock

NOWSHERA: A 16-year old boy, who came into contact with fallen LT electric conductor of MES, received an electric shock and was seriously injured at Jhangar, Nowshera.
The boy identified as Ritik Sharma, son of Mangat Ram, resident of Jhangar who was returning after his usual visit to Mandir in the evening, suddenly came into contact with a live electric conductor which had fallen on ground, and was seriously injured.
The boy was immediately shifted to Sub District Hospital Nowshera but due to his critical condition he was evacuated to Government Medical College Hospital Jammu.
The villagers strongly criticized the MES department for its utter negligence due to which the son of a poor farmer is struggling between life and death. They demanded that the department should provide financial assistance to the poor family for the treatment of the injured boy.
